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u will undergo surgery for a hernia on Sunday, his office announced in a statement.
Netanyahu’s office said the hernia was found Saturday night during a routine checkup. During the procedure, he will undergo full anesthesia and be unconscious. In the United States, hernias are common, affecting 25% of all men throughout their lifetime.
